Binary File Parsing
Binary file parsing is the process of reading and interpreting binary files, which store data in a raw, non-text format using sequences of bytes. It involves understanding the file's structure, such as headers, metadata, and data sections, to extract meaningful information programmatically. This skill is essential for working with proprietary formats, multimedia files, executables, and network protocols where data is encoded for efficiency or security.
Developers should learn binary file parsing when dealing with low-level data processing, such as reverse engineering, malware analysis, or developing tools for specific file formats like images, audio, or video. It is crucial in fields like cybersecurity for analyzing binaries, in game development for handling assets, and in embedded systems where memory and performance constraints require compact data representation. Mastery enables efficient data extraction, validation, and manipulation without relying on high-level libraries.
